Team News

Hull boss John Cartwright is boosted by the return to fitness of half-back Aiden Sezer, who was flying at the start of the season.

The former Leeds man has been sidelined by a shoulder injury but is named in the squad this week. Also included after injury is forward Jordan Lane, who broke his arm in the derby earlier this year.

Ed Chamberlain is ruled out with a rib injury, while Will Gardiner comes in for Jack Charles in the other change.

Leigh have the luxury of naming an unchanged squad, and I wouldn't expect to see any major changes to the side that lined up against Leeds last week.

Leigh need a result this week badly, and I am expecting a really entertaining game. Hull FC have been great to watch but have really struggled at home, notwithstanding last week's 14-try demolition of a Salford side who would be put down if they were an animal at the vets.

I'm expecting a big response from the Leopards after coming unstuck at home to Leeds last week, and they know that another defeat will most likely see the Rhinos leapfrog them into the top four. A win, however, could reignite hopes of even finishing in the top two, given Hull KR and Wigan are playing each other.

It's a tight contest to call - as evidenced by the four-point handicap - and a big start can lay the platform for either side to go on and win the game.

So, for me, it just comes down to who is the better team right now, and in my opinion, that is Leigh.

Hull FC won this fixture away at Leigh 26-12, so this feels like the perfect time for the Leopards to exact their revenge and get back on track.
